This is my friend Alex. He is seven years old. 

He loves to bake. He bakes many cakes. He loves to eat them too. 

Alex goes to school in town. His school is painted red, green, and black. After school, he likes to get his haircut in a low style. 


Read the questions out loud. 

1. What is the boy's name?


2. How old is the boy? 


3. Where does he go to school? 


4. What colour is his school?


5. How does he get his haircut?




Up in the Air



Ethan loves planes. He loves small planes and big planes. He loves all planes!


Some day, he wants to be a pilot. He will fly from Barbados to other countries. 

One day, his mother told him a secret. "We are going to see a plane at the airport," she said. Ethan was so happy. 

They took a bus to the airport in Christ Church. When they got there, Ethan saw a large airplane. It was the largest plane he ever saw. 


"Hello," a man said. "I am the pilot. Would you like to see the inside of the plane?" The pilot asked. Ethan was happy to go on board. He climbed the tall steps. He saw many buttons and large seats. This was the best day ever!

1. What does Ethan want to be when he is older?

2. Where did Ethan's mother take him?

3. In what parish is the airport?

4. What did Ethan see on the inside of the plane?
